The difference between chicken reproduction and mammalian reporduction is:

  • chickens lay eggs and incubate them outside thier body. The young hatch from eggs and may be sufficiently developed not to need much if any adult care as they grow.
  • mammals hold the developing young within the body until they are able to survive outside the boddy. Mammalian young are born live, and may require much support from adults as they grow to self-sufficiency.

Similarities and differences between chicken heart and mammilian heart?

Both chicken hearts and mammalian hearts serve the primary function of pumping blood throughout the body, and both have four chambers—two atria and two ventricles, although the structure and arrangement can vary. A key difference lies in their physiology: chicken hearts are more efficient for their high metabolic demands during flight, while mammalian hearts are adapted for a wide range of activities, including sustained endurance. Additionally, chicken hearts have a more compact structure, while mammalian hearts exhibit a greater degree of specialization in their chambers and valves. Lastly, the regulation of heart rate and contraction can differ due to variations in hormonal and neural controls.
